Side-by-Side Comparison

Feature cavar clavar
Definition Retirar la tierra para hacer un hoyo o una excavación. Introducir un objeto puntiagudo en un cuerpo, mediante presión o golpes.

Spelling & Dictionary Insight

A purely visual mix-up. cavar ([kaˈβ̞aɾ]) and clavar ([klaˈβ̞aɾ])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one.
